What is ride sharing?

Ride sharing is a form of transportation where multiple people share a ride in a vehicle going to the same destination. It can also include carpooling, where people share a ride with others who have similar destinations or routes. This service is provided by car sharing companies that allow people to rent a car for a certain period, paying only for the time and distance they use the vehicle. Unlike traditional taxi services, ride sharing enables people to share their rides with others, which helps them to save money and reduce their carbon footprint.

How does ride sharing work?

Ride sharing works by connecting people who need a ride with those who have a car and are going in the same direction. Car sharing companies such as Zipcar, Uber, and Lyft have developed technology platforms that allow users to find and book a ride in a matter of minutes using a smartphone app. Drivers who have signed up with these services can offer rides to people who are looking for a way to get around. The app matches the driver and the rider based on their location, destination, and preferences, and determines the fare based on the distance and time of the ride.

Benefits of ride sharing

Ride sharing has numerous benefits, both for individuals and for society as a whole. Here are some of the advantages of this mode of transportation:

– Cost savings: Ride sharing allows people to split the cost of transportation, which can significantly reduce their expenses. This is especially beneficial for people who commute to work daily or for those who need to travel frequently for business or leisure activities.

– Environmental benefits: Ride sharing reduces the number of vehicles on the road, which helps to reduce traffic congestion and air pollution. This is particularly important in urban areas, where traffic congestion is a major concern. By sharing rides, people can reduce their carbon footprint and contribute to a cleaner environment.

– Convenience: Ride sharing is a convenient alternative to traditional transportation methods. With the help of a smartphone app, people can find and book a ride within a few minutes, without having to wait in long lines or hail a cab on the street.

– Social benefits: Ride sharing enables people to interact with others and build social connections. It also helps to reduce social isolation and loneliness, as people can share a ride and chat with others.

Challenges of ride sharing

While ride sharing has many benefits, there are also some challenges associated with this mode of transportation. Here are some of the challenges:

– Safety concerns: There are concerns around safety when it comes to ride sharing. Drivers and riders need to be careful when sharing personal information and when engaging in rides with strangers. Car sharing companies need to ensure that their drivers have undergone proper background checks and that their vehicles are safe and well-maintained.

– Regulatory issues: The rise of ride sharing has brought up regulatory issues around licensing, insurance, and taxes. Governments need to find ways to ensure that ride sharing services are safe, reliable, and compliant with local laws and regulations.

– Infrastructure: To make ride sharing more effective, there is a need to invest in infrastructure such as dedicated carpool lanes, parking facilities, and charging stations for electric vehicles.
